Two million Americans live with a growth disorder. Normal growth is a sign of good health in children, whereas growing below or above the norm denotes a growth disorder and underlying health issues. Author Lizabeth Peak provides young readers and researchers a means of understanding growth disorders and their ramifications. Readers will learn what specific conditions are, what causes them, how people live with them, and the latest information about treatment and prevention.
